"I'm not entirely convinced about websocket solutions in Python yet, but I've been told flask-websockets is awesome. Nevertheless this doesn't solve the problem for you. Cause the request is just keeping an open line and waiting for a response....blocking is bad." Tornado only blocks if you do something silly. It's event based, and can keep hundreds of connections open and waiting for it's async response event before actioning/responding the open connection.

"The most simplest advise I would have is to have the ajax request trigger a background task and return immediately. The background task will then have some kind of side effect (ie. write some result to a database somewhere) which the ajax request can the look for with some kind of polling mechanism (on some other endpoint)." Wow, overkill much? Polling is bad, and is exactly the kind of bad solution that a lot of these libraries are in place to prevent developers from needing to do.

Websockets were made to solve the long-polling and poll-spamming that was prevalent. Now all you have to do is keep a light, open web-socket connection to the server. And the server, being async/evented, will respond when the task is good and ready. Nice and clean.



"Tornado only blocks if you do something silly. It's event based, and can keep hundreds of connections open and waiting for it's async response event before actioning/responding the open connection." - Yes pure tornado based apps are probably fine if you know what you are doing.

"Wow, overkill much? Polling is bad, and is exactly the kind of bad solution that a lot of these libraries are in place to prevent developers from needing to do." - Polling is not bad if you have a good use case. You just cannot do non-blocking stuff with Django for instance, or it's very very hard and tricky. Websockets also limit you with the number of connections you can have open at once.
